Ordinals
beta
Address 1BMVse7bAtRWCViNwor66XqMAbY8qsdCSf
sat balance
784399
runes balances
outputs
e373c93132ec5ab7fb7b4cac59b4aa6935c45d19f0502e8099ccc69d8d72ba8f:1